This virtual 2-day programme is available on-demand.
Participating helps learners to improve their technical
writing and communication skills.
Day one focusses on reviewing different
forms of technical writing, writing style, conventions, and best practice.
Day
two extends these principles to digital forms of communication such as
instant messaging, collaboration, and project tracking.
Participants are invited to review their own technical documents and how they currently utilize
digital communication tools (email, messaging, etc.), identifying areas for
improvement.
Peer to peer learning is supported in order to continually improve skills within attendees' organizations post-course completion.
